Daniel Crane is one of Britain's leading sporting artists. He specialises in narrative scenes which epitomise life in the countryside.
A recent diversion to Daniel’s portfolio includes the wonderful opportunity to have been chosen to be the Household Cavalry Mounted Regiment’s Resident Artist, a post he obtained just prior to the Royal Wedding & still has today. Many of these paintings were sold successfully raising significant funds for the Household Cavalry Foundation. The Official painting of the Diamond Jubilee, commissioned by the Officers of the regiment, hangs in the Officer’s Mess at the Knightsbridge Barracks. He was also chosen to paint the greatest racehorse of all time, Frankel, and the World & Olympic Dressage Champion, Valegro for the 130th Anniversary Edition of Horse & Hound to mention a couple of his many prestigious commissions.
